What Buyers Should Know About Tempe, AZ Homes in July 2026?
Tempe, AZIf you are buying in Tempe, AZ in July 2026, my answer is yes, but only if you stay selective and move with a plan. With 4.03 months of inventory and homes closing at 97.6% of asking price, you still have choices, yet you do not have unlimited room to delay once the right home shows up. The latest mix favors buyers who know their ceiling, know their must-haves, and are ready to act when the numbers line up.
The most recent sold median is $485,000, and sold homes took a median 35 days to get to sold status. Those two numbers give you a practical target: price the home against what has actually closed, not against what is sitting unsold and hoping for attention.
I would not expect much help from waiting. A home that fits your budget and your timing can still draw interest quickly, and the closer it is to a realistic market price, the faster you need to decide whether it belongs on your short list.
Start with financing, then compare active homes to the sold median before you tour. Keep a second and third option ready, and write with confidence when a home checks your boxes and lands close to recent closings.
